Transaction 31d1b5106e74fdf65db2d0972cde9b2498b26cacecfeb8635cd03677d858052e
1 Input
1 Output
-
31d1b5106e74fdf65db2d0972cde9b2498b26cacecfeb8635cd03677d858052e:0
- value
- 149203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24cdeadf262c8b378611d5b1263d28085d109c57 OP_EQUAL
- address
- 353cvr2auZ1Pqx9aas7zir6ccrQBVgRb2C